Proudly celebrating its incredible 10th anniversary, Seven Drunken Nights - The Story of The Dubliners is back! Performed by a phenomenal cast of Irish musicians, the show is packed full of classics such as Whiskey in the Jar, The Irish Rover and Rocky Road to Dublin - guaranteed to get your toes tapping as they bring the joy of this much-loved Irish folk band back to the stage.
With breathtaking performances and authentic Irish spirit, the show spans over 50 years, commemorating The Story of The Dubliners with a celebration of the band that influenced many generations of Irish music.
This ultimate feel-good production celebrates the musical mastery of The Dubliners, Ireland’s favourite sons, in association with the legendary O’Donoghue’s pub.
